ITI Banking and Financial Services Fund

(An open ended equity scheme predominantly investing in banking and financial services)

CATEGORY OF SCHEME Sectoral/ Thematic Fund
INVESTMENT OBJECTIVE The investment objective of the scheme is to generate long-term capital appreciation from a portfolio that is invested predominantly in equity and equity related securities of companies engaged in banking and financial services. However, there can be no assurance that the investment objective of the scheme would be achieved.
Inception Date (Date of Allotment): 06-Dec-21
Benchmark: Nifty Financial Services TRI
Minimum Application Amount: Rs. 5,000/- and in multiples of Re. 1/- thereafter
Load Structure: Entry Load: Nil
Exit Load:1% if redeemed or switched out on or before completion of 12 months from the date of allotment of units ยท Nil, if redeemed or switched out after completion of 12 months from the date of allotment of units.
